Default How to preserve state of View-Toolbars?

How does one preserve the checked/un-checked state of a toolbar in
View-Toolbars? For example, adding adding a toolbar in the Workbook_Open
event after checking for a specific add-in (per Ron de Bruin's solution in
question "Detect if a command bar is enabled in View"), closing the workbook
reopening, the toolbar is visible and checked again. I'd like to test if the
user had previously un-checked the visual display of the toolbar. I tried
itterating thropugh the commandBars collection and looking at the enabled
property, but this doesn't appear to be where excel saves that state.
